This volume covers a variety of the latest scientific methods utilized in tick-borne virus (TBV) research. The chapters in this book explore detailed protocols on how to conduct in-depth research on TBVs; enhance understanding of the virus’ biology; transmission mechanisms; and the creation of effective countermeasures. Following the established Methods in Molecular Biology series format, each chapter introduces the topic, lists necessary materials and reagents, offers step-by-step reproducible laboratory protocols, and includes troubleshooting tips to help avoid common issues.
